I discovered this today by randomly scrolling on my startscreen. I know I might seem crazy :grin: but since I found this it's been bothering me a lot (just because I know it's there, not visually bothering). Just look at the guidelines in the attached picture; you can clearly see that the Twitter and Cortana tiles are 2px taller and 2px wider than the other tiles. I'm not sure if it's just my phone or if it's every other phone but anyway, here is the picture: WTF.png

This started to get interesting. I removed the background picture and all the tiles are how and where they should be. Put it back on and they are again different sizes. (and no, I'm definitely not hallucinating :grin:)
